Abstract

Skin, muscle, and internal organs are composed of soft tissues. Mechanics of soft tissues therefore includes mechanics of all organs, and thus covers a vast area. Advances in soft tissue mechanics have been made mainly in association with detailed investigations of organ physiology. Thus soft-tissue mechanics is not an abstract subject but is one of real life, concerned with explaining how living being works.
